About CDC NSW

ComfortDelGro Corporation Australia (CDC) is the largest private bus operator in NSW. Our people are our most valued asset, they are the heart of our success.

Operating in seven countries with over 24,300 employees and serving more than 2 million commuters daily.

We are part of an international company with an impressive global footprint and a reputation for providing a safe and reliable public transport network that meets customer and community needs.
